Table 3. Genome statistics.
| Attribute | Value | % of Total |
|---|---|---|
| Genome size (bp) | 3,783,444 | 100.00% |
| DNA coding region (bp) | 3,166,256 | 83.69% |
| DNA G+C content (bp) | 1,719,313 | 45.44% |
| Number of replicons | 1 | |
| Extrachromosomal elements | 0 | |
| Total genes | 3,597 | 100.00% |
| RNA genes | 44 | 1.22% |
| rRNA operons | 1 | |
| Protein-coding genes | 3,553 | 98.78% |
| Pseudo genes | 181 | 5.03% |
| Genes with function prediction | 2,289 | 63.64% |
| Genes with paralog clusters | 1,591 | 44.23% |
| Genes assigned to COGs | 2,383 | 66.25% |
| Genes assigned Pfam domains | 2,554 | 71.00% |
| Genes with signal peptides | 1,130 | 31.42% |
| Genes with transmembrane helices | 860 | 23.91% |
| CRISPR repeats | 0 |
